Installing datreant.core¶
You can install datreant.core
from PyPI using pip:
pip install datreant.core
It is also possible to use --user
to install into your user Python
site-packages directory:
pip install --user datreant.core
All datreant packages currently support the following Python versions:
- 2.7
- 3.3
- 3.4
- 3.5
Dependencies¶
The dependencies of datreant.core
are light, with many being pure-Python
packages themselves. The current dependencies are:
- asciitree
- pathlib
- scandir
- six
- fuzzywuzzy
These are automatically installed when installing datreant.core
.
Installing from source¶
To install from source, clone the repository and switch to the master branch
git clone git@github.com:datreant/datreant.core.git
cd datreant.core
git checkout master
Installation of the packages is as simple as
pip install .
This installs datreant in the system wide python directory; this may require administrative privileges. If you have a virtualenv active, it will install the package within your virtualenv. See Setting up your development environment for more on setting up a proper development environment.
It is also possible to use --user
to install into your user’s site-packages
directory:
pip install --user -e .
